      Former Chargers assistant coaches.. Siranni and Steichen are heading to the Super Bowl. Sirianni gave up play calling duties to Steichen, which has been instrumental in the success of the Eagles the past couple of seasons now. Hurts is limited in my opinion as a downfield thrower, but the Eagles are still very able to utilize what Hurts does well.

      I am thinking it’s got to be apparent now that both Steichen and Pep had a bit to do with Herbert’s historic rookie season, along with some nice offensive pieces that worked well with Herbert also, even if the offensive line was as dreadful. I am truly hopeful that the Chargers make a solid hire at OC and passing coordinator for Herbert’s sake mostly. I’m kinda of curious if Staley is not successful next season, do the Chargers select yet another offensive coordinator for Herbert??

                  I liked Lombardi too, so please don’t misunderstand. Steichen did what he did with a poor offensive line unit. That part sticks out most to me. Rookie QB with one of the poorest offensive line performances I can remember is usually not a good recipe for success. Even now, I am not sure if any members from that group did well afterwards, outside of Pippen.
                  Most of that OL are backups or out of the league. Sam Tevi is unsigned, Forrest Lamp is unsigned, Dan Feeney is a backup guard/center on that shitty Jets OL, Trai Turner got benched last year by the Commanders and was relegated to backup for several games before they had to start him again, and Bulaga is retired and out of the league I assume now.
